Book Description: Physical Design for 3D Integrated Circuits reveals how to effectively and optimally design 3D integrated circuits (ICs) while exploring the benefits of 3D technology. The book begins by providing an overview of physical design challenges compared to conventional 2D circuits, followed by in-depth looks at specific physical design topics in each chapter. It covers all aspects of physical design, from device physics to circuit performance, and provides a comprehensive understanding of the field.
